This guide is written for parents and carers who want to understand how AI tools are being used in their children's schools.
It explains, in plain language, what AI tools do in educational settings, how student data is typically handled, what safeguards should be in place, and what questions parents can ask schools about their AI use.
The guide covers common AI applications including feedback tools, content generators, adaptive learning platforms, and monitoring tools, explaining the benefits and risks of each in an accessible way.
It includes a one-page summary of questions parents can take to school governors or parent forums.
